Born: May 19, 1921 Lynnville, Iowa
Died: May 16, 2001 Sioux Falls, South Dakota

Raymond Huyser, 79, of Rock Valley died Wed. May 16, at Sioux Valley Hospital in Sioux Falls.

Services were at 10:30 a.m. Sat. at First Reformed Church with the Rev. Dr. Michael Van Hammersveld officiating. Burial was in Valley View Cemetery at Rock Valley.

Huyser was born May 19, 1921 in Lynnville, the son of Henry and Elizabeth (Maassen) Huyser. He moved with his family to the Inwood area as a child. He attended Inwood Country School and them worked on the family farm. He married Katherine Schoep on Dec. 15, 1944, in Carmel. The couple farmed the Schoep farm, then purchased a farm southwest of Rock Valley, where they farmed for seven years. Then they bought a farm east of Rock Valley, where they farmed for 20 years. They moved into Rock Valley in 1979. He was a volunteer at the local hay sale and sale barn. He also did missionary work in Annville, KY, for 15 years. He later was a volunteer with Hope Haven in the Wheelchair repair shop. He enjoyed traveling.

Survivors include his wife; a son and his wife, Robert and Lorna of Rock Valley; three daughters, Linda and her husband Dwaine De Groot of Rock Valley, Audrey and her husband Dan Mulder of Doon and Karen Link of Des Moines; two sisters, Stella Van Veldhuizen and Frieda and her husband Jake Van Voorst of Inwood; a sister-in-law, Mary Huyser of Inwood; 14 grandchildren; six great-grandchildren; and many nieces and nephews.

He was preceded in death by two brothers, John and Cornie.
